西門子供應數控軟件代理商
| 更新時間 2024-11-01 08:50:00 價格 請來電詢價 聯系電話 15344432716 聯系手機 15386422716 聯系人 楊本剛 立即詢價 |
西門子供應數控軟件代理商
PLC是什么意思?相信很多人處于大概知道是什么,但是又無法準確說出的階段,作為專注于為企業提供數據采集和設備控制解決方案的眾誠工業,今天和大家探討一下。
而眾誠工業還能根據用戶需求,設計PLC控制程序,為客戶提供PLC編程和上位機軟件的定制化開發技術服務,滿足用戶的多種需求,比如,自主研發的潔凈空調智能控制系統和通風排風智能控制系統就配置PLC,不僅具有報警和定時控制功能,還兼具可擴展性和兼容性,系統能被第三方系統集成。
以上PLC的基本介紹,相信大家對PLC也有一個初步的了解。PLC的型號、品牌不同,對應著其結構形式、性能、編程方式等等都有所差異,價格也各不相同,在挑選時候,建議先要明確自己的應用需求,比如具體的應用場景,希望實現的運動和控制功能,已經特殊的控制要求,這些將決定了PLC的選型和搭配組合。
簡單地說,PLC就是一種小型的計算機,和我們常用的計算機不同的是,PLC是設備之間通過數字信號進行互動,而我們常用的計算機,是人和計算機的互動。
控制是PLC的核心功能,其控制類型主要分為以下幾種1、開關量的開環控制。這是PLC*基本的控制功能,它能憑借其強大的邏輯運算能力,取代傳統繼電接觸器的控制系統;
2、數據采集與監控。這是PLC非常必要的功能,否則它將無法完成現場控制;
3、數字量智能控制。PLC具有實現接收和輸出高速脈沖的功能,近年來先進的PLC還開發了數字控制模塊和新型運動單元模塊,讓工程師更加輕松地通過PLC實現數字量控制;
4、PLC能通過模擬量采集和調節溫度、壓力、速度等參數。
正因為PLC功能強大,且具有設計方便、重量體積小、能耗低、改造工作量小、通用性強、維護方便等易學易用的特點,深受工程師的歡迎,因此應用非常廣泛,鋼鐵、石油、化工、紡織、交通、機械制造等等行業都能看到它的身影。
據類型 1 說明 IN1,IN2 [...IN32] SInt, Int, DInt, USInt, UInt, UDInt, Real, LReal,Time, Date, TOD, 常數 數學運算輸入(*多 32 個輸入) OUT SInt, Int, DInt, USInt,UInt, UDInt, Real, LReal, Time, Date, TOD 數學運算輸出 1 IN1、IN2 和 OUT參數的數據類型必須相同。 要添加輸入,請單擊“創建”(Create) 圖標,或在其中一個現有 IN 參數的輸入短線處單擊右鍵,并選擇“插入輸入”(Insert input) 命令。 要刪除輸入,請在其中一個現有 IN參數(多于兩個原始輸入時)的輸入短線處單擊右鍵,并 選擇“刪除”(Delete) 命令。 表格 8-61 ENO 狀態 ENO 說明1 無錯誤 0 僅適用于 Real 數據類型: ? 至少一個輸入不是實數 (NaN)。 ? 結果 OUT 為 +/-INF(無窮大)。 8.5.8 LIMIT(設置限值) 表格 8-62 LIMIT(設置限值)指令 LAD/FBD SCL 說明LIMIT(MN:=_variant_in_, IN:=_variant_in_, MX:=_variant_in_,OUT:=_variant_out_); Limit 指令用于測試參數 IN 的值是否在參數 MIN 和 MAX and ifnot, clamps the value at MIN or MAX. 指定的值范圍內 1 對于 LAD 和FBD:單擊“???”并從下拉菜單中選擇數據類型。數據類型 1 說明 MN, IN 和 MX SInt, Int, DInt,USInt, UInt, UDInt, Real, LReal, Time, Date, TOD·常數 數學運算輸入 OUTSInt, Int, DInt, USInt, UInt, UDInt, Real, LReal, Time, Date, TOD數學運算輸出 1 參數 MN、IN、MX 和 OUT 的數據類型必須相同。 如果參數 IN 的值在指定的范圍內,則 IN的值將存儲在參數 OUT 中。如果參數 IN 的值超出 指定的范圍,則 OUT 值為參數 MIN 的值(如果 IN 值小于 MIN值)或參數 MAX 的值(如果 IN 值大于 MAX 值)。 表格 8-64 ENO 狀態 ENO 說明 1 無錯誤 0Real:如果 MIN、IN 和 MAX 的一個或多個值是 NaN(不是數字),則返回 NaN。 0 如果 MIN 大于MAX,則將值 IN 分配給 OUT。 SCL 示例: ? MyVal := LIMIT(MN:=10,IN:=53,MX:=40); //結果:MyVal = 40 ? MyVal := LIMIT(MN:=10,IN:=37, MX:=40);//結果:MyVal = 37 ? MyVal := LIMIT(MN:=10,IN:=8, MX:=40); //結果:MyVal= 10 8.5.9 指數、對數及三角函數指令 使用浮點指令可編寫使用 Real 或 LReal 數據類型的數學運算程序: ?SQR:計算平方 (IN 2 = OUT) ? SQRT:計算平方根 (√IN = OUT) ? LN:計算自然對數 (LN(IN)= OUT) ? EXP:計算指數值 (e IN =OUT),其中底數 e = 2.704523536 ?EXPT:取冪 (IN1 IN2 = OUT) EXPT 參數 IN1 和 OUT 總是為同一數據類型,可以選定為 Real 或LReal??梢詮谋姸鄶祿?類型中為指數參數 IN2 選擇數據類型。 ? FRAC:提取小數(浮點數 IN 的小數部分 =OUT) ? SIN:計算正弦值(sin(IN radians) = OUT) ? ASIN:計算反正弦值(arcsine(IN) = OUT 弧度),其中sin(OUT 弧度) = IN ? COS:計算余弦(cos(IN 弧度) = OUT) ? ACOS:計算反余弦值(arccos(IN) = OUT 弧度),其中 cos(OUT 弧度) = IN ? TAN:計算正切值(tan(IN 弧度) =OUT) ? ATAN:計算反正切值 (arctan(IN) = OUT 弧度),其中 tan(OUT 弧度) = IN 表格8-65 浮點型數學運算指令示例 LAD/FBD SCL 說明 out := SQR(in); 或 out := in * in;平方:IN 2 = OUT 例如:如果 IN = 9,則 OUT = 81。 out := in1 ** in2; 綜合指數:IN1IN2 = OUT 例如:如果 IN1 = 3 且 IN2 = 2,則 OUT = 9。 1 對于 LAD 和FBD:單擊“???”(按指令名稱)并從下拉菜單中選擇數據類型。 2 對于 SCL:還可以使用基本的 SCL數學運算符來創建數學表達式。 表格 8-66 參數的數據類型 參數 數據類型 說明 IN, IN1 Real, LReal, 常數輸入 IN2 SInt, Int, DInt, USInt, UInt,UDInt, Real, LReal, 常數 EXPT指數輸入條件 結果 (OUT) 1 全部 無錯誤 有效結果 0 SQR 結果超出有效 Real/LReal 范圍 +INF IN 為+/- NaN(不是數字) +NaN SQRT IN 為負數 -NaN IN 為 +/- INF(無窮大)或 +/- NaN +/-INF 或 +/- NaN LN IN 為 0.0、負數、-INF 或 -NaN -NaN IN 為 +INF 或 +NaN +INF或 +NaN EXP 結果超出有效 Real/LReal 范圍 +INF IN 為 +/- NaN +/- NaN SIN, COS,TAN IN 為 +/- INF 或 +/- NaN +/- INF 或 +/- NaN ASIN,ACOS IN 超出 -1.0 到+1.0 的有效范圍 +NaN IN 為 +/- NaN +/- NaN ATAN IN 為 +/- NaN +/- NaN FRACIN 為 +/- INF 或 +/- NaN +NaN EXPT IN1 為 +INF 且 IN2 不是 -INF +INF IN1為負數或 -INF 如果 IN2 為 Real/LReal,則 為 +NaN, 否則為 -INF IN1 或 IN2 為 +/-NaN +NaNMOVE(移動值)、MOVE_BLK(移動塊)、UMOVE_BLK(無中斷移動塊)和MOVE_BLK_VARIANT(移動塊) 使用移動指令可將數據元素復制到新的存儲器地址并從一種數據類型轉換為另一種數據類型。移動過程不會更改源數據。 ? MOVE 指令用于將單個數據元素從參數 IN 指定的源地址復制到參數 OUT 指定的目標地址。 ?MOVE_BLK 和 UMOVE_BLK 指令具有附加的 COUNT 參數。COUNT 指定要復制的數據元素個數。每個被復制元素的字節數取決于 PLC 變量表中分配給 IN 和 OUT 參數變量名稱 的數據類型。 表格 8-68MOVE、MOVE_BLK、UMOVE_BLK 和 MOVE_BLK_VARIANT 指令 LAD/FBD SCL 說明 out1:= in; 將存儲在指定地址的數據元素復制到新地址 或多個地址。1 MOVE_BLK( in:=_variant_in,count:=_uint_in, out=>_variant_out); 將數據元素塊復制到新地址的可中斷移動。UMOVE_BLK( in:=_variant_in, count:=_uint_in, out=>_variant_out);將數據元素塊復制到新地址的不可中斷移 動。 MOVE_BLK_VARIANT( SRC:=_variant_in,COUNT:=_udint_in, SRC_INDEX:=_dint_in, DESTINDEX:=_dint_in,DEST=>_variant_out); 將源存儲區域的內容移動到目標存儲區域。 可以將一個完整的數組或數組中的元素復制到另一個具有相同數據類型的數組中。源數 組和目標數組的大?。ㄔ財盗浚┛梢圆?同??梢詮椭茢到M中的多個或單個元素。源數組和目標數組都可以用 Variant 數據類型 來指代。 1 MOVE 指令:要在 LAD 或 FBD中添加其它輸出,請單擊輸出參數旁的“創建”(Create) 圖標。對于 SCL,請使用多個賦值語句。還可以使用任一循環結構。 要添加 MOVE輸出,請單擊“創建”(Create) 圖標,或右鍵單擊現有 OUT 參數之 一的輸出短線,并選擇“插入輸出”(Insertoutput) 命令。 要刪除輸出,請在其中一個現有 OUT 參數(多于兩個原始輸出時)的輸出短線處單擊右鍵,并選擇“刪除”(Delete) 命令。 表格 8-70 MOVE_BLK 和 UMOVE_BLK 指令的數據類型 參數 數據類型 說明IN SInt, Int, DInt, USInt, UInt, UDInt, Real, LReal Byte, Word,DWord, Time, Date, TOD, WChar 源起始地址 COUNT UInt 要復制的數據元素數 OUT SInt,Int, DInt, USInt, UInt, UDInt, Real, LReal, Byte, Word, DWord,Time, Date, TOD, WChar 目標起始地址 表格 8-71 MOVE_BLK_VARIANT 指令的數據類型 參數數據類型 說明 SRC Variant(指向數組或單獨的數組元素) 欲進行復制操作的源塊 COUNT UDInt 要復制的數據元素數SRC_INDEX DInt SRC 數組的零基索引
對于數控機床制造企業來說,選擇合適的數控軟件代理商是一個重要的決策。在這方面,湖南西控自動化設備有限公司-西門子模組是一個授權代理的可靠選擇。西門子數控軟件代理商擁有豐富的研究進展、實用建議和領域案例,能夠為客戶提供全面而優質的服務。
研究進展作為西門子數控軟件代理商,湖南西控自動化設備有限公司-西門子模組一直致力于跟蹤和研究數控軟件的*新進展。他們與西門子緊密合作,掌握*新的技術動態和功能特點。無論是針對加工精度的提升,還是對加工效率的優化,西門子數控軟件代理商都可以根據*新的研究成果,為客戶提供精準的解決方案。
實用建議選擇一家可靠的西門子數控軟件代理商,不僅僅是購買產品,更是獲取專業的技術支持和實用的建議。湖南西控自動化設備有限公司-西門子模組擁有豐富的經驗和專業知識,可以根據客戶的需求以及特定的行業要求,提供定制化的解決方案。無論是初次購買還是升級換代,他們都能夠給出專業的建議,幫助客戶實現**的效果。
領域案例作為西門子數控軟件代理商,湖南西控自動化設備有限公司-西門子模組在多個領域都有成功的案例。無論是汽車制造、航空航天、醫療設備還是電子制造,他們都能夠為客戶提供行業特定的解決方案。通過分享這些領域案例,西門子數控軟件代理商向客戶展示了他們的專業能力和實際效果,增強了客戶的信心。
問答問:為什么選擇西門子數控軟件代理商?
答:選擇西門子數控軟件代理商的原因有很多。首先,他們是西門子的授權代理商,擁有豐富的經驗和專業知識。其次,他們不僅能夠提供優質的產品,還能夠為客戶提供全面的技術支持和實用的建議。*重要的是,他們在多個領域都有成功的案例,可以為客戶提供行業特定的解決方案。
問:如何選擇適合自己的西門子數控軟件代理商?
答:選擇適合自己的西門子數控軟件代理商需要考慮多個因素。首先要確保代理商具有豐富的經驗和專業知識,能夠根據客戶的需求提供定制化的解決方案。其次要了解代理商在相關領域的成功案例,看看他們是否有實際的行業經驗。*后還要考慮代理商與西門子的合作關系,確保能夠獲得*新的技術支持和產品更新。
,選擇湖南西控自動化設備有限公司-西門子模組作為西門子數控軟件代理商是一個明智的決策。他們擁有豐富的研究進展、實用建議和成功案例,能夠為客戶提供全面而優質的服務。無論是提升加工精度還是優化加工效率,他們都將是您*可靠的合作伙伴。
聯系方式
- 電 話:15344432716
- 銷售顧問:楊本剛
- 手 機:15386422716
- 微 信:AK66F7